About the Role

Inspects production or first-run parts, units, and assemblies made from a variety of materials such as plastic, fiberglass, metal, or wood, particularly where bonding agents or adhesives are used. Responsibilities include inspecting bonded parts or parts to be bonded prior to, during, and after the bonding process. May disassemble parts at the bond line to assess bond quality and perform various inspection tests to ensure adherence to specifications.

Works from blueprints, specifications, or verbal instructions, using precision measuring instruments, gauges, jigs, fixtures, and templates to determine acceptability. Performs complex inspection layouts and setups to verify work meets required standards or specifications. Rejects items that fail to meet standards and maintains records, graphs, and charts on bonding procedures, tests, and related data.

Aids, guides, and assists other inspectors in proper bonding inspection methods and procedures. Handles the most complex and difficult bonding or attest inspection work. Performs all phases of inspection on formed and machined plastic parts, assemblies, and materials through visual examination or specialized tools to ensure adherence to blueprints, specifications, and standards.

Operates saws, drill presses, shapers, sanders, and pull test machines to prepare and test bonded parts. May perform destructive testing as required.
